Can a gene-silencing drug calm overactive complement in kidney disease?
NCT ID NCT07730632
First seen Jul 28, 2026 · Last updated Jul 29, 2026 · Updated 1 time
Summary
This phase II trial tests an experimental drug called QLS7305 in people with several kidney diseases driven by overactivation of the complement system, a part of the immune system. The drug is a small interfering RNA (siRNA) designed to reduce production of complement protein C3, potentially lowering inflammation and protein leakage into urine. Researchers are enrolling about 60 adults with IgA nephropathy, C3 glomerulopathy, immune complex membranoproliferative glomerulonephritis, or primary membranous nephropathy to see if the drug can safely reduce proteinuria over 12 weeks.

- Active substance
- QLS7305, an experimental siRNA drug that targets complement C3 to reduce kidney inflammation
- What this could lead to
- If successful, this could provide a new treatment option for several complement-mediated kidney diseases, potentially slowing disease progression.
- What could go wrong
- This is an early phase II trial with only 60 participants, so results may not confirm efficacy or safety. The drug targets a key immune pathway, which could increase infection risk.
